Cynthia Erivo Lead, Ariana Grande Supporting

The two actresses at the center of Evilby Jon M. Chuthe highly anticipated film adaptation of the hit Broadway musical, which Universal will release nationwide on November 22 — will Not will compete in the same acting category this awards season, The Hollywood Reporter he learned.

The decision was made to push Cynthia Erivothe Grammy-winning and Oscar-nominated actress who will play Elphaba (who becomes the Wicked Witch of the West), in the leading actress category, and Ariana Grandethe Grammy-winning and SAG Award-nominated actress, who will play Glinda (who becomes the Good Witch), in the supporting category.

This path is different from the one imposed on the original Broadway production by the Tony Awards Administration Committee 20 years ago. So, Idina Menzelwho created Elphaba, and actresswho gave birth to Glinda, both competed in the Best Actress in a Musical category; both received nominations; in the end, Menzel won.

However, the strategy for the next film makes a lot of sense, given that only five films have ever managed to get multiple actress nominations at the same time in the Best Actress category at the Oscars, only All about Eva (1950), Suddenly, last summer (1959), The turning point (1977), Terms of Affection (1983) and Thelma and Louise (1991) — and how competitive this year's female acting categories are proving to be.
